WWU Summer Dance Theater Auditions Open to the Public May 15

As the opening move of a series of dance and theatre offerings this summer, Western Washington University will hold auditions for “Graffiti Dance Theater” at 6 p.m. on Friday, May 15, in Studio B of the Commissary building.

The dance company is looking for 10 to 15 members, and both students and community members alike are encouraged to audition. Schedule availability will be an important factor in the selection process, and choreographers will also be a part of the performing company. Those interested in choreographing work should contact Nolan Dennett as soon as possible. All company members will receive a stipend, and there is the possibility of summer scholarships for any student enrolled in at least two dance classes.

Five student works will be restaged this season. Rehearsals for the dance group will begin on Saturday, June 20, and the first performance will be Saturday, July 25 at the Orcas Center, located at 917 Mt. Baker Road in Eastsound. The group will perform in Western’s Viking Union Multipurpose Room from July 29 through Aug. 2.
